This week we started our next unit in writing. We will be practicing writing How To Books. In order to gain a better understanding of this style of writing, the students helped me with the steps of making a peanut butter and jelly sandwich. We invited Mr. Kowalczyk in to make the peanut butter and jelly sandwich based solely on what the students decided were good steps. After Mr. K made his "sandwich" we revised our writing and added many more steps and we will be inviting Mr. K back into our classroom next week to see if he will be able to make a sandwich!
